## Authentication

Quillhopper handlers run on the Fenwick serverless runtime, where cold starts re-initialize the auth client on every new instance. To avoid a token-exchange round trip during cold start, the handler authenticates against the internal Mossgate service with a static key injected at deploy time. The key is scoped read-only and rotated quarterly. For local testing, the handler expects the key on the line below.

API key for tagef-fafop: vxb2-ta

## Step 4: Enable log compaction on Quillbus

Heads up: once you flip compaction on for the `orders-events` topic, Quillbus will start pruning superseded keys on the next segment roll. Don't panic if disk usage briefly spikes — that's the cleaner doing its first pass. Make sure the retention overrides from Step 3 are already applied, or you'll compact too aggressively. Before restarting the broker, paste in the following settings exactly as shown below.

deployment values, yadug-bawif:
[framir]
team = pelox
access_code = ac_a38ab2
owner = tamion.julael
host = framir.tolvaqlabs.test
port = 11211
peer = tammir.zemvargrid.local
salt = 2215ef03
pin = 1541

Re: feed validator in Pondcast — mostly fine, but don't hardcode the retry and timeout numbers inline. We've been burned when partners like Larkwell publish feeds with 40MB episodes and the validator stalls. Pull everything into the constants module: fetch timeout, max enclosure size, redirect hop limit, and the malformed-item tolerance. Also add a comment pointing reviewers here. For reference, these are the values the old Crumbleaf validator shipped with.

limits module of kahag-fajop:
QUOTAS = {
    "wenwyn": 10,
    "zorath": 1,
}

## Deploying the Gatewick Proctor Queue

Deploys are pretty painless: push to main, wait for the pipeline, then watch the queue drain dashboard for five minutes. If candidates pile up mid-exam, roll back first and ask questions later — the queue replays safely. Everything the workers care about lives in one config block, shown here for reference.

settings of bafof-yagef:
JOROX_PIN=8740
JOROX_TENANT=pelox
JOROX_METRICS_HOST=metrics.jorox.qorvelworks.internal
JOROX_SEAL=seal_c78f63c1
JOROX_STANDBY_TEAM=norax